Imagine Charter Middle School at Cortez Park, located in Phoenix, Arizona, is a charter middle school. Based on its state test results, it has received a GreatSchools Rating of 4 out of 10.
The school community has reviewed this school and given it an average rating of 4 out of 5 stars.
